When should pre-emergent go down in Statenville, Georgia?
Timing is everything - it goes down before soil temperatures hit germination, which in Statenville is usually early spring and again in late summer. Miss the window and you are chasing weeds all season.
How long until weeds die after treatment?
Most broadleaf weeds curl within a week or two. Tough ones like nutsedge need a repeat visit, which a Statenville program includes rather than charging again.
